-- Enable PostGIS extension if not enabled
CREATE EXTENSION IF NOT EXISTS postgis;
-- Create table for countries if not exists
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S countries_boundaries (
country TEXT PRIMARY KEY CHECK (country ~ '^[a-z]{2}$'),
boundary GEOMETRY(MULTIPOLYGON, 4326) NOT NULL
);
-- Add spatial index if not exists
CREATE INDEX IF NOT EXISTS countries_boundaries_index_1
ON countries_boundaries
USING GIST (boundary);
C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ION find_countries(locations BIGINT[][])
RETURNS TABLE (country TEXT) AS $$
SELECT DISTINCT enclosing_countries.country
FROM unnest(locations) AS location_array(lng, lat)
JOIN LATERAL (
SELECT country
FROM countries_boundaries
-- Convert microdegrees to degrees and check if the location lies within the country boundary.
WHERE ST_Contains(
boundary,
ST_SetSRID(
ST_MakePoint(lng / 1000000.0, lat / 1000000.0),
4326
)
)
) AS enclosing_countries ON TRUE;
$$ LANGUAGE sql STABLE;
